Our Differential Encoders without Index Channel are transmissive optical encoder modules. These modules are designed to detect rotary position with a codewheel when added to the end of an Anaheim Automation dual shaft motor. These Differential Encoders consist of a lensed LED source and a monolithic detector IC enclosed in a small polymer package. These modules use phased array detector technology to provide superior performance and greater tolerances over traditional aperture mask type encoders. They provide digital quadrature differential outputs on all resolutions. These encoders are powered from a single +5VDC power supply. Also, they are RoHS compliant.

- Small Size, Pre-Mounted to Dual Shaft Motor
- 32 to 1,250 Cycles Per Revolution (CPR)
- Tracks from 0 to 100,000 Cycles Per Sec
- 2-Channel Quadrature Differential Squarewave Outputs
- Accepts +/-0.010" Axial Shaft Play
- -40° C to + 100°C Operating Temperature
- RoHS Compliant and REACH Certified
